Recent blackouts in power systems have shown the necessity of vulnerability assessment. Among all factors, TRANSMISSION system components have a more important role. Power system vulnerability assessment could capture cascading outages which result in large blackouts and is an effective tool for power system engineers for defining power system bottlenecks and weak points. In this paper a new method based on fault chains concept is developed which uses new measures. GENETIC algorithm with an effective structure is used for finding vulnerable branches in a practical power TRANSMISSION system. Analytic hierarchy process is a technique used to determine the weighting factors in fitness function of GENETIC algorithm. Finally, the numerical results for Isfahan Regional Electric Company are presented which verifies the effectiveness and precision of the proposed method according to the practical expriments.

In this paper a new framework is presented for multi–objective TRANSMISSION Expansion Planning (TEP). This framework is based on a multiple criteria decision making whose fundamental elements are REliability and MARKet (REMARK). Investment cost, congestion cost, Users' Benefit (UB) and Expected Customer Interruption Cost (ECOST) are considered in the optimization as four objectives. The proposed model is a complicated non-linear mixed-integer optimization problem. A hybrid GENETIC Algorithm (GA) and Quadratic Programming (QP) is used, followed by a Fuzzy Sets Theory (FST) to obtain the final optimal solution. The planning methodology has been demonstrated on the 6-machine 8-bus test system to show the feasibility and capabilities of the proposed algorithm. Also, in order to compare the historical expansion plan and the expansion plan developed by the proposed methodology, it was applied to the real life system of the northeastern part of Iranian national 400-kV TRANSMISSION grid.

In this article, an attempt has been made to estimate the amount of sound TRANSMISSION loss in a flat oval channel by applying the approach of statistical energy analysis. Correct estimation of sound TRANSMISSION loss in an air conditioning channel is of great importance due to the harmful effects of noise pollution in the environment on human health. Simulation with the statistical energy analysis method is a powerful approach to estimate sound and vibration in problems in which we deal with complex and multi-part systems; is considered. In this method, first, a system is divided into several subsystems, and then by writing a matrix equation that includes the energy exchanges between subsystems and energy loss coefficients; It is investigated from the perspective of vibration and sound estimation.On average, the model presented in this research is able to estimate the sound TRANSMISSION loss in different dimensions of the air conditioning channels according to the experimental results in the accuracy range of ± 2.5 dB. Considering that it seems that the results obtained from modeling with this method are in good agreement with the experimental data; The results of this research can be used as an efficient approach to estimate noise in oval shaped channels stretched in different lengths.

In this article, a new combined approach of a decision tree and clustering is presented to predict the TRANSMISSION of GENETIC diseases. In this article, the performance of these algorithms is compared for more accurate prediction of disease TRANSMISSION under the same condition and based on a series of measures like the positive predictive value, negative predictive value, accuracy, sensitivity and specificity. The results show that support vector machine algorithm outperformed the other two simple algorithms and the neural network and GENETIC algorithms offered better prediction at the end, while the proposed combined approach is developed using different parameters and outperformed the simple methods.

In the present paper, power TRANSMISSION interaction of multilayered sound isolation panels consists of porous, solid materials and air gaps using Transfer Matrix Method (TMM) has been considered. Considering the theories related to acoustical behavior of multilayered panel lined with poroelastic materials, detail explanation of TRANSMISSION Loss (TL) of a panel via TMM has been presented. Calculation of TL for a specified panel via TMM has been compared to existed experimental data in the literature and excellent agreement is observed. Next, based on this verified model, a multi-objective optimization of multilayered panel has been conducted using NSGA-II to maximize TL of panel while the panel weight is kept to a minimum. Results of two-objective optimization reveals, if the designer target is to achieve a specific average TL in the frequency band of 10 to 500 Hz, for a panel with constant width, selecting a panel with lower layers (three layers) can bring lower weight. But, if a higher average TL in the same frequency band is desired, a panel with more layers (six layers) has much better conditions in terms of weight.

TRANSMISSION towers are the most important part of the systems for transferring electrical power and for its distribution. These structures are designed to support the conductors and ground wires of electrical power lines and withstand mechanical forces in the worst weather and under the worst atmospheric conditions. A linear analysis is generally sufficient for the analysis of a TRANSMISSION tower. Since these structures contain a high number of elements, and due to their high cost, their optimization is of great importance from both a material and a construction point of view. TRANSMISSION towers are often subjected to many combinations of loading and, in the process of optimization; one is faced with many analyses. In this paper, a GENETIC algorithm is employed for optimization. One of the main difficulties in using the GENETIC algorithm for optimization is that, for each chromosome in each generation, one analysis should be performed. This requires the inversion of matrices and, with an increase in the number of elements and in geometric optimization, the convergence becomes very slow. In order to overcome this difficulty, neural networks are trained as analyzers to take on part of the computational load. Using neural networks increases the rate of convergence of the optimization. A multi-population GENETIC algorithm is used in this article.

IN THIS PAPER, FIRST, WE INTRODUCE UPFC MODEL AND DERIVE ITS EQUATIONS USING TWO POLE CIRCUIT PROPRIETIES. THEN WE EXPRESS OPTIMAL POWER FLOW (OPF). OBJECTIVE FUNCTION IN THE OPF, THAT IS TO BE MINIMIZED, IS TOTAL PRODUCTION COST FUNCTION OF THE GENERATORS. THE OPF CONSTRAINTS ARE GENERATORS, TRANSMISSION LINES AND UPFCS LIMITS. WE PROPOSE GENETIC ALGORITHM WITH AN EFFECTIVE FITNESS FUNCTION TO CONSIDER THE OBJECTIVE FUNCTION AND ALL EQUALITY AND INEQUALITY CONSTRAINTS. ALSO WE EXPLAIN IMPLEMENTATION OF THIS METHOD. WE DRIVE DC LOAD FLOW IN POWER SYSTEMS CONTAINED UPFC. DC LOAD FLOW IS USED TO SOLVE THE OPF PROBLEM. WE APPLY THE PROPOSED METHOD TO A TEST POWER SYSTEM AND STATE ITS RESULTS. THE RESULTS SHOW GOOD EFFICIENCY OF THE GENETIC ALGORITHM AND PROPOSED FITNESS FUNCTION TO SOLVE THE PROBLEM WITH ALL GENERATION AND TRANSMISSION AND UPFC CONSTRAINTS. ALSO WE SHOW THAT THE UPFC CAN CONTROL THE POWER FLOW IN LINES AND HELP KEEP RE-DISPATCHED VALUES OF GENERATORS TO CLOSE TO PREFERRED SCHEDULES. THE UPFC CAN BRING THE SYSTEM INTO A FEASIBLE OPERATING CONDITION IN CASES WHERE SECURITY CANNOT BE ACCOMPLISHED WITH EXISTING NETWORK CAPACITIES AND MAY ALLOW MORE CONTRACTS TO BE HELD IN A RESTRUCTURED ENVIRONMENT.
